Overview of San Juan City Hospital Program Internal Medicine Residency
The San Juan City Hospital Program Internal Medicine Residency is a three-year program that offers a unique training experience for residents. The program is based in San Juan, Puerto Rico, and is affiliated with the University of Puerto Rico. The program is designed to provide residents with a comprehensive training experience that prepares them for a successful career in internal medicine.
The program is accredited by the Accreditation Council for Graduate Medical Education (ACGME) and accepts 11 residents per year. How to Apply to San Juan City Hospital Program Internal Medicine Residency
If you are interested in applying to the San Juan City Hospital Program Internal Medicine Residency, there are several steps you need to take. First, you will need to complete an application through the Electronic Residency Application Service (ERAS). The program participates in the National Resident Matching Program (NRMP) and uses the Electronic Residency Application Service (ERAS) for applications.
The application deadline for the program is typically in late October or early November. Interviews are conducted between November and January, and match results are typically released in mid-March.
